Lake St Catherine State Park: frequently asked questions
Is Lake St Catherine State Park's water safe to drink?
Lake St Catherine State Park is an active transient non-community water system regulated under the Safe Drinking Water Act, overseen by the VT state drinking water program. EPA SDWA violation and enforcement records for this system are being added to AquaCensus from EPA ECHO; consult EPA ECHO or your annual Consumer Confidence Report for its current compliance status.
Who runs Lake St Catherine State Park?
Lake St Catherine State Park (PWSID VT0008042) is a state government-owned transient non-community water system, regulated by the VT state drinking water program.
How many people does Lake St Catherine State Park serve?
Lake St Catherine State Park reports serving 246 people through 15 service connections in Rutland County, Vermont.
Where does Lake St Catherine State Park get its water?
EPA SDWIS lists this system's primary water source as groundwater.
